Transaction e86cf0083fca4c77bbfd38a08b65ff0513d06fd2eaa905d664c208a98491c252
1 Input
1 Output
-
e86cf0083fca4c77bbfd38a08b65ff0513d06fd2eaa905d664c208a98491c252:0
- value
- 621822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47f0fa4e4dfbc69e09dc6326d9804c004b52caa7 OP_EQUAL
- address
- 38FQabH9rBmpXU1g1Wv7zfPEUZnMDoiscr